On Tue, Jul 01, 2025 at 01:53:53AM +0530, Brahmajit Das wrote:
> Building with make allyesconfig on musl results in the following
>
> In file included from samples/check-exec/inc.c:23:
> /usr/include/sys/prctl.h:88:8: error: redefinition of 'struct prctl_mm_map'
> 88 | struct prctl_mm_map {
> | ^~~~~~~~~~~~
> In file included from samples/check-exec/inc.c:17:
> usr/include/linux/prctl.h:134:8: note: originally defined here
> 134 | struct prctl_mm_map {
> | ^~~~~~~~~~~~
>
> This is mainly due to differnece in the sys/prctl.h between glibC and
> musl. The struct prctl_mm_map is defined in sys/prctl.h in musl.
>
